DRDO SHYEN Maritime Patrol Suite for Dornier 228
SHYEN (SENTINEL FOR MARITIME DOMAIN AWARENESS)
DRDO SHYEN Maritime Patrol Suite for Dornier 228 (Brochure AERO INDIA 2025)
KEY FEATURES
SHYEN is an integrated sensor suite consisting of Maritime Patrol Radar. Electronic Support Measures System, Electro Optical Infra-Red System and Software Define Radio which generates a comprehensive surveillance picture of the targets from Radar or ESM or EOIR (Day/lR image) enabling classification and target identification communicating via SDR data link for enhanced Maritime Domain Awareness
SPECIFICATIONS
> KSHITIJ Maritime Patrol Radar
• Long Range, 360 degree rotating AESA based Maritime Surveillance Radar
• Comprehensive Sea Surveillance, Air Surveillance, Ground Surveillance (Spot/Strip SAR & GMTI) and Navigation Aide (Weather & Search/Rescue)
• Artificial intelligence for Target Classification
> ESM
• Interception, Analysis and Geolocation of Ground, Shipborne and Airborne Emitters, Wide Spectral and Spatial Coverage
• High Accuracy of Parameters including Direction Finding (DF)
• Tactical, Situational & Tabular Views for Situational Awareness
> EOIR
• SWaP optimized State-of-Art common aperture optical channel
• HD imagery, Day TV Camera, Thermal Imager, Short Wave & Medium Wave Infra-Red Camera
• Loser Designator cum eye-safe Laser Range Finder (LDRF)
• Line-of-Sight Target Detection and Automatic Target Tracking
> Software Defined Radio (SDR)
• Communications services in V/UHF band, L Band and Line SATCOM band
• Support for Air-Ground, Air-Ship and Air-Air Communications
• Software Architecture conforming to SCA 4i

06 March 2023 : LRDE Tender
Installation of KSHITIJ Radar ESM EOIR and SDR payloads on DRDO FTB (Tender Refrence Number : LRDE/MMFD-PUR/22-23/23ATT035)
1. Introduction
LRDE has undertaken a project which is aimed at indigenization of four critical payloads for the Do-228 aircraft. The details of payloads and corresponding DRDO labs responsible for their development are indicated below:
S.N. Payload DRDO Lab
1. KSHITIJ Maritime Patrol Radar LRDE
2. EOIR (Electro Optic Infra-Red) IRDE
3. SDR (Software Defined Radio) DEAL
4. ESM (Electronic Support Measure) DLRL
1.1. System Configuration
LRDE is the nodal lab and is responsible for Aircraft Modification, Installation, Integration and Demodification of Payloads (KSHITIJ Radar, ESM, EOIR, SDR) intended for Do-228 Aircraft. As HAL is the OEM for Do-228 Aircraft, the activity of installation of the payloads on the aircraft, clearances for/and shakedown trails will be done by HAL. DRDO, FTB (Do-228, Tail No: KD707) for will be used for payload installation and evaluation purposes.
• Four Payloads to be developed as part of the project (KSHITIJ Radar, ESM, EOIR, and SDR).
3. Electronic Support Measure (ESM)
3.1. System Description
The ESM System will receive signals in the frequency band of 0.5-40GHz according to the mission programmed by the operator. The pre-flight mission data programming will be operator selectable with flexibility in system programmable features. The received signals after suitable conditioning and amplification will be processed by fast sampling Processing units with Instantaneous Bandwidth of 1000 MHz to supply the emitter tracks. Further sub bands can be programmed at digital level. The facility of inter and intra pulse analysis and library matching will be provided as an inherent feature of the system. 4. EO-IR (IRDE)
4.1. System Description
The Electro Optical Imaging Intelligent Stabilized System (EOI2SS) being developed for surveillance aircraft will be high performance dual axis 4 – Gimbal stabilized sighting systems for long range surveillance and reconnaissance with advanced tracking and image processing features and various digital interfaces. EOI2SS will be primarily a surveillance sight for the Do-228 aircraft for surveillance over sea/ocean. It will consist of EO sensors viz. Thermal Imager (Zoom & NFOV Spotter) (IIIrd Gen, MWIR, HD), Day TV (Zoom & NFOV Spotter (Colour, HD), SWIR Camera (NFOV Spotter) (HD) & Eye Safe Laser range finder / Laser Target Designator. Video target tracking capability facilitates high precision aiming on the target in dynamic conditions. The system will have advanced Tracking features and Geo Pointing and Geo Steering features. This facilitates long range surveillance, target acquisition and auto tracking during day as well as night
5. Software Defined Radio (SDR)
5.1. System Description
Airborne SDRs are the latest development in Aviation communication which provides encrypted Voice and Data capability including Mobile Adhoc Networking.
Both the Radio-LRUs will support V/UHF band on one channel having integrated 25W V/UHF PA, 50 watts L-Band and 100 watts UHF Band SATCOM PAs inside the LRU. A Radio Control Unit (RCU) will be used for management, configuration, monitoring and waveform/crypto parameters loading. 04-RCU configuration as per Naval requirements has been finalized – 02 (Master + Standby) in the central pedestal of cockpit and 02 at operator station in the rear. Later on, the 02 rear RCU will be replaced with HMI on TMS consoles as and when available. This multi-channel radio will have multiple data and audio ports. The voice will be interfaced with Audio Management Unit of the Airborne Platform (02 V/UHF + 01 UHF SATCOM).
The SDR system will be a four-channel radio having two V/UHF (30-512 MHz) channels, one L-Band (960-1240 MHz) and one UHF SATCOM channel. The SDR systems comprises of 03 major LRUs:

03 November 2024
A very cool news
For the MLU for 25 Navy Do 228, DRDL under Project SHYEN S-22 has developed local ESM modules.
On Sep 27, 2024, ESM system received approval for installation, development, and user flight trials following the successful completion of user laboratories evaluation

20 February 2025
DRDO Flying test bed Anushandhan kitted out with Shyen mission suite.
Shyen comprises a GaN based aesa search radar, common aperture long range EO, ESM and COMINT systems.
This Do 228 flew at Aero India 2025 with Dr BK Das, DG ECS, DRDO.
03 June 2025 : DRDO Products For Export 2025 PDF
Kshitij : Maritime Surveillance Airborne X Band Radar System
The versatile Maritime Surveillance Airborne X Band Radar System is designed for maritime surveillance and Search and Rescue (SAR) missions. It is easily adaptable to a variety of platforms for search, detection and tracking of multiple targets at long range. The radar has good sea-clutter suppression features to detect small targets. In addition to the standard air to sea surface search modes with TWS, this radar provides high resolution range signature and ISAR image of the target which enables the user to classify the intercepted target. There is an air to air mode to detect and track aerial targets. Other modes include weather avoidance, beacon and navigation. The Radar provides 360° azimuth coverage in both belly and chin mounted configuration.
Main Features
• Programmable signal and data processor
• Sea-clutter mitigation techniques
• Short blind zone for landing on ship
• High instantaneous bandwidth
• High resolution modes - RS and ISAR
• Interleaved TWS and RS Profile
• Staring mode for ISAR
• Display orientation
• Aircraft heading reference
• North reference
• Fixed ground reference (True motion)
• Navigation waypoint and ground map overlay
• Weather avoidance with 4 color coding
• Detection of SART Beacon for search and Rescue
• ECCM
16 November 2025 : MoD Annual Report Year 2024-25
Kshitij Radar for Shyen Project
DRDO is the nodal organization for development of the sensor suite for the Dornier Mid Life Upgrade program of the Indian Navy. The Radar uses an X band active array antenna with Transmit Receiver (TR) modules in a tile configuration. The development flight sorties for radar were conducted &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) imagery for planned test points was obtained. During the year 2024, User Lab Evaluation has been completed in two phases for Electronic Support Measures (ESM) system. The ESM System is being installed in the Aircraft at a DPSU
